  • In this video, you'll learn how to create stunning 3D meshes from point clouds using Python. We'll use the popular Python library Open3D to create a 3D mesh from a point cloud. We'll also show you how to visualize the mesh using CloudCompare or MeshLab

    Point clouds are a collection of 3D points that represent the surface of an object. They are often used in 3D scanning and photogrammetry. This video is for beginners who want to learn how to create 3D meshes from point clouds using Python. No prior experience with Python or Open3D is required.
